Becoming A Member - A pastor issues the invitation to join at the end of the worship service. (See the Invitation to Discipleship & Church Membership” in the worship bulletin.) You are asked to join the pastors at the altar and receive the vows of membership. At the end of the service the congregation has an opportunity to welcome you. You will also be invited to an orientation class designed to give new members and visitors an introduction to Methodism, our congregation’s vision and ministry. These classes are held two – three times a year.

Are you joining a church for the first time and have never been baptized?
Any person desiring to confess faith in Jesus Christ as Savior and wishing to serve Him as your Lord, may become a member of the church by Profession of Faith. If you have not been baptized, the pastor will administer this Sacrament.

Are you currently a member of another denomination?
If you are already a member a member of another denomination, we receive you by your covenant vows. You will be transferring your membership to John Wesley United Methodist Church. The United Methodist Church honors baptisms from other Christian denominations so new members will not be baptized again. After receiving you into the United Methodist Church, we will contact your former church and advise them of your new membership.

Are you currently a member of another United Methodist Church?
If you are a member of another congregation of the United Methodist Church, we will receive you by Transfer of Membership. The church office will write and secure a Certificate of Transfer for you.
